    Quote Originally Posted by Kiote View Post
    YOu have describe the Party roles of every Class. Solo Combat is what classes are for and they operate completely differently. You cannot honestly believe that Conjurers Soloed by "Mostly Healing"
    You're oversimplifying what these class revisions have to offer. They are far more complex and tactical classes then you're making them out to be.

    Gladiators specialized in Reactive WSs and Shutting down enemy abilities. They now have No offensive Skills
    They had paltry offensive skills to begin with. With the guard changes that have already taken place Phalanx was a shadow of what it once was before, and it was the only Reactive WS they had. All of their offensive ability was in their weapons skills which all basically did the same damage at lower levels. Other offensive ability came from what they could cross class. They still have offensive weapon skills in the adjusted list, and using combos increases their damage. And they now have MORE options in regards to reactive abilities. They also still have shield bash and can stun in place of Riot Blade pacification effect. The ability to shut down enemy abilities is still there as well.

    Lancer was a Tactical fighter with a steady defense. They are now all out DD with no Tactics or Defense
    Lancer is still tactical and strategic. You can increase your TP through the use of an ability, increase the damage of your next attack. And reduce the recast of your next weaponskill. Your auto attacks can steal HP. You lose out on an attack speed ability, being able to transfer enmity, and you're obvious weaker in defense. But you can manipulate your TP and weapon skill recasts in order to initiate combos more frequently, and take advantage of the effects offered by those combos. In place of Diversion you can absorb HP from an attack directly, which can be boosted by depleting the effects of one of your other abilities.

    Conjurer was an Run and Gun nuker who specialized in mitigating Damage and elemental magic. They now heal.
    CON still specializes in mitigating damage by healing, because healing is and always has been a method of doing so. They can also generate a barrier around a target that prevents damage. Similar to Stoneskin. Their damage mitigation potential is still intact. They also have a version of protect. They have their own nukes that can inflict additional effects. They also have an ability that can increase their magic attack at the cost of healing ability. So now CON is a well-balanced class that can switch from support to nuking when the situation arises. Wow. That's pretty much what they were before.

    Thaumaturge specialized in Enfeeballing and Nuking to take down enemies and absord spells to boost their skills. Now they nuke.
    This one is true. They are a more destructive class now. And all of their nukes have additional effects. They can still enfeeble through their damage spells, although the enfeebles aren't the same as before. They no longer have absorbs. or Sac. Or dedicated enfeeble spells.
